What this means for you

If you are a creditor

Contact the administrator to register your claim. You cannot start or continue legal action against the company without the court's or administrator's permission. Unsecured creditors are typically paid last.

If you are an employee

Employees are preferential creditors for certain unpaid wages and holiday pay, and may be able to claim from the Redundancy Payments Service if roles are made redundant.

If you are a customer

Orders, deposits and warranties may be affected. Deposits paid are usually unsecured claims. Contact the administrator about outstanding work or refunds.

If you are a supplier

Goods supplied before the appointment are an unsecured claim. Check whether any retention-of-title clause applies to goods you can identify and recover.

What does administration mean for creditors of Crafts & Woollens Limited?
Administration is a formal insolvency process that gives a company protection from creditors while an administrator tries to rescue it or achieve a better result than liquidation. Creditors cannot start or continue legal action without permission. Unsecured creditors are usually paid last, often only a portion of what they are owed, if anything.
